Output 12adad58b69452b65d8a08f1422b4836d60bb60d5dd54315a43eecbf1e23c62a:0

value
93085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5b7cc9af9cd4804d5ea3145e79a9acaa22e730 OP_EQUAL
address
3MsSrbde2EVBMDUbfmejU4Djm9Mk6LaqwH
transaction
12adad58b69452b65d8a08f1422b4836d60bb60d5dd54315a43eecbf1e23c62a
spent
true